Pizzeria Lola: A Minneapolis Standout
Located in Minneapolis, Pizzeria Lola stands out with its distinctive Korean-inspired take on wood-fired pizza. The restaurant, a favorite of Fieri and recognized by Yelp Elites, boasts an intriguing menu. Options range from the traditional 'My Sharoni' (pepperoni, fennel sausage) and 'Tavern Pie' (pepperoni, jalapeno, honey) to more adventurous creations like the 'Korean BBQ' and 'Lady Zaza' featuring ingredients like beef short ribs, kimchi, and gochujang. A recent review highlighted an exceptional experience, praising the perfectly cooked pizza, high-quality pepperoni cups, flavorful fennel sausage, and one of the best gluten-free crusts encountered, made in-house. The ambiance, centered around a prominent brick oven, adds to the appeal. While the quality justifies the cost, diners should budget accordingly for a meal in Minneapolis.
The Local: Farm-to-Table Flavors in Naples
In Naples, Florida, The Local exemplifies the farm-to-table concept, earning its own DDD feature. Chef and owner Jeff Mitchell realized a long-held dream when his restaurant, focused on scratch cooking with locally sourced ingredients, was selected for the show. Fieri spotlighted their 'prime-time pastrami with pickled relish' and 'knockout gnocchi with pork ragu,' showcasing the restaurant's commitment to quality and flavor. The feature is part of a broader Naples focus for DDD, which has also included spots like The Rooster Food + Drink and Molto Trattoria. Being on the show was a fast-paced but rewarding experience for Mitchell, who praised Fieri's genuine passion for food and kindness.
